Tetanus Vaccine, Prevention, Causes, Early Symptoms & Wound
Things to know about tetanus Picture of Clostridium tetani, with spore formation (oval forms at end of rods). Source: CDC/Dr. Holdeman Tetanus is frequently fatal infectious disease. Tuberculosis (TB) Treatment, Test, Vaccine & Symptoms
Things to know about tuberculosis (TB) Tuberculosis (TB) is a multisystemic infectious disease caused by the Mycobacterium tuberculosis bacterium. Tuberculosis (TB) is an infectious disease that’s transmitted from person to person. Is Cholera Contagious? History, Causes, Treatment & Vaccine
Things to know about cholera Cholera is a disease that causes foul-smelling diarrhea that looks like rice water. Cholera is a disease caused by bacteria that produce watery diarrhea that can rapidly lead to dehydration.
